What companies run services between Chinatown, Singapore and Delfi Orchard, Singapore?

SMRT operates a subway from Maxwell to Orchard every 15 minutes. Tickets cost $1–2 and the journey takes 9 min. Alternatively, Tower Transit Singapore operates a bus from Opp State Ct to Royal Plaza On Scotts every 15 minutes. Tickets cost $2–3 and the journey takes 15 min.
